It must be every skydivers nightmare, to have your parachute fail to open when you are in freewill towards Earths surface. According to the Metro, that’s what happened to one professional skydiver at the weekend.

Last weekend, Russian national Dimitri Didenkoa (30) was performing a solo wing suit jump at Jurien Bay in Perth, Australia during the Virtual Nationals Skydiving Competition but his parachute failed to open.
Mr Didenkoa had more than 6000 jumps completed.
Sadly, Mr Didenkoa died at the scene.
The Civil Aviation Safety Authority and the Australian Parachute Federation will carry out an investigation into exactly what happened.
